Shade and Hydration: Mitigating Afternoon Heat Stress

One of the best ways to protect your plants from the scorching afternoon sun is by providing shade. This can be achieved through the strategic use of shade cloths, which can be drawn during the hottest parts of the day. Hydration is equally important. Ensuring that your plants have enough water will help them cope with the heat, as water plays a critical role in regulating plant temperature.

Moreover, consider the timing of your watering. Early morning is ideal, as it allows the water to reach the roots before the heat of the day causes evaporation. If watering in the afternoon, aim for late in the day when the sun is less intense, so that the plants have time to absorb the moisture before nightfall.

Sunlight Scheduling: Timing Matters for Optimal Photosynthesis

Photosynthesis is the engine of plant growth, and it runs on sunlight. But not all hours of sunlight are equally effective. The morning sun kickstarts this process, while the afternoon sun powers through it. Therefore, scheduling the right amount of sun exposure at the right times is essential.

Consider using automated systems to control the amount of light your plants receive. Timers on shade cloths or dynamic glass that adjusts its opacity can be invaluable tools in managing light exposure. By controlling the environment, you can ensure that your plants receive the optimal amount of sunlight throughout the day.

For example, a grower in the northern hemisphere might position their greenhouse to capture the maximum amount of morning sunlight in the winter months when the sun is lower in the sky, while using shade cloths to protect against the intense afternoon sun in the summer.

It’s all about timing and understanding the needs of your plants. With the right setup, you can harness the power of the sun to its full potential, without causing harm to your crops.

Green Thumb Tactics: Adjusting Greenhouse Setup for Light Management

Adjusting your greenhouse setup for optimal light management can make a significant difference in plant health and yield. Here are some tactics to consider:

  • Orientation: Position your greenhouse to maximize morning sunlight, especially during the cooler months.
  • Shade Cloths: Use them to diffuse intense afternoon sunlight, preventing leaf burn and heat stress.
  • Reflective Surfaces: Place them strategically to bounce light into shadier parts of the greenhouse.
  • Glazing Options: Choose materials that balance light transmission with insulation properties.
  • Monitoring: Keep an eye on light levels with sensors to ensure your plants are getting what they need.

By implementing these tactics, you can create a controlled environment that allows your plants to thrive under the best possible conditions.

FAQ on the Sun`s Impact on Greenhouse Crop

Do all plants in a greenhouse require the same amount of sunlight?

No, different plants have varied requirements for sunlight. For instance, leafy greens may prefer less intense light and can thrive in partial shade, whereas fruiting plants like tomatoes and peppers often need more direct sunlight to produce a healthy yield. Understanding the specific sunlight needs of each plant variety is crucial for greenhouse success.

Can greenhouses still be productive in areas with less natural sunlight?

Absolutely. Greenhouses can be equipped with supplemental lighting to provide the necessary light levels for plant growth. This is especially useful in regions with long winters or extended periods of cloud cover. Growers can use a combination of natural and artificial light to maintain consistent light conditions, ensuring year-round productivity.

  • Install grow lights to compensate for low natural sunlight.
  • Use reflective materials to maximize light dispersion.
  • Consider light-diffusing greenhouse covers that distribute light more evenly.

What adjustments can be made for greenhouse plants in extreme climates?

In extreme climates, whether hot or cold, managing the internal environment of a greenhouse is key. For hot climates, proper ventilation, shading, and evaporative cooling systems can help maintain suitable temperatures. In colder climates, insulating materials, heating systems, and maximizing sunlight exposure are important to keep plants warm and growing.

How does the angle of the sun impact the light intensity inside a greenhouse?

The angle of the sun changes with the seasons and affects how much sunlight enters the greenhouse. During summer, the sun is higher in the sky, and sunlight is more direct. In winter, the sun’s lower angle can reduce the intensity of sunlight reaching the plants. Adjusting the orientation of the greenhouse and the use of reflective surfaces can help optimize light intake year-round.

What tools can help monitor and manage sun exposure in greenhouses?

To effectively manage sun exposure in greenhouses, growers can use a variety of tools:

  • Light meters to measure the intensity of sunlight.
  • Thermometers and hygrometers to monitor temperature and humidity.
  • Automated shade systems that adjust based on light levels.
  • Timers for supplemental lighting to ensure consistent light exposure.

By leveraging these tools, growers can create the optimal conditions for their greenhouse crops, maximizing yield and ensuring plant health.
